What is UPVC?
UPVC is a type of plastic that is extensively used in the building market, especially for doors and window frames. Unlike regular PVC, UPVC does not consist of plasticizers, that makes it rigid and ideal for structural applications. The material is resistant to wetness and environmental deterioration, offering it a longer life expectancy compared to conventional products like wood and metal.
Advantages of UPVC Windows and Doors
Resilience: UPVC is extremely resistant to rot, deterioration, and fading, making it an excellent option for environments with severe weather.

Energy Efficiency: UPVC frames can help enhance the energy efficiency of homes. They are excellent insulators, which means they can help decrease cooling and heating costs.

Low Maintenance: Unlike wood frames that may need routine painting and sealing, UPVC can just be cleaned up with soap and water, maintaining its appearance with minimal effort.

Cost-efficient: Although the preliminary investment might be greater than aluminum or wooden alternatives, the long lifespan and low upkeep requirements of UPVC make it a more cost-effective choice over time.

Aesthetically Pleasing: UPVC doors and windows come in various designs and colors, making sure property owners can discover an alternative that matches their residential or commercial property.

UPVC items come in different designs to suit various architectural styles and personal preferences. Some typical types include:
Windows:Casement Windows: Hinged at the side, these windows open outside, providing excellent ventilation.Sliding Windows: These windows operate on a track, permitting simple opening and closing.Sash Windows: Featuring sliding panes, sash windows offer a traditional look and functionality.Tilt and Turn Windows: Versatile in style, these windows can tilt for ventilation or turn completely for easy cleaning.Doors:UPVC Front Doors: Designed to offer security and insulation, these doors are available in numerous designs.French Doors: These double doors open outward and produce a smooth link to outside spaces.Sliding Patio Doors: Ideal for taking full advantage of views and natural light, these doors run smoothly along a track.Bi-fold Doors: These doors can fold back to develop an open area, ideal for entertaining or linking indoor and outside areas.Benefits of UPVC Doors and Windows

Setup Process
The installation of UPVC doors and windows is important for guaranteeing their functionality and durability. Here are the crucial actions included in the setup procedure:

Measurement: Accurate measurements of the existing openings are taken.

Preparation: The old frames are gotten rid of, and the area is cleaned up and prepped for the new setup.

Placement: The new UPVC frames are placed, guaranteeing they fit snugly within the openings.

Sealing: The frames are sealed using proper sealing materials to avoid drafts and water ingress.

Completing: Final changes are made to guarantee the windows and companies doors operate efficiently, and any complements are added.
Maintenance Tips for UPVC Windows and Doors
To keep UPVC windows and doors in great condition, the following maintenance suggestions are recommended:

Regular Cleaning: Use a wet fabric or sponge with moderate soap to wipe down the frames and glass surface areas. Avoid extreme chemicals that can harm the material.

Inspect Seals and Locks: Regularly inspect the sealing and locking systems to guarantee they are operating properly.

Oil Moving Parts: Use a silicone-based lubricant on hinges and locks to keep them operating efficiently.

Check for Damage: Periodically check for any visible damage or wear to deal with problems before they intensify.
Frequently Asked Questions About UPVC Windows and Doors
How long do UPVC windows and doors last?
UPVC doors and windows can last upwards of 20 years with correct maintenance.
Are UPVC items energy effective?
Yes, UPVC provides excellent insulation residential or commercial properties, which can significantly enhance energy efficiency in homes.
Can UPVC windows be painted?
While UPVC can be painted, it's normally not advised, as this may void service warranties and affect the product's integrity.
Are UPVC products recyclable?
Yes, UPVC is recyclable, making it an eco-friendly choice.
Can I set up UPVC doors and windows myself?
While DIY installation is possible, it is suggested to hire professionals for correct and protected installation.
